Saint-Gobain Performance Plastics Microelectronics Business
Announces Key Supplier Arrangement with SCP Global Technologies
GARDEN GROVE, CA - July10, 2003 - Saint-Gobain Performance Plastics
Microelectronics Business announced today a partnership with
industry leader SCP Global Technologies, Inc. (SCP). Saint-Gobain's
initial focus will be to concentrate on the development of SCP's
new precision surface preparation system.
In addition to supporting SCP's new product development program,
Saint-Gobain will also support the development of SCP's E200© and
Eclipse300T tools' second-generation plumbing modules. Both the
E200© and the Eclipse 300T are world-class surface preparation
tools used in the processing of semiconductor wafers.

Established in 1975, SCP Global Technologies has been an industry
leader in the development of wet processing equipment used in the
manufacture of semiconductor wafers. The company continues its
commitment to being the worldwide leader in the supply of
cost-effective surface preparation technology, systems and services

Saint-Gobain Performance Plastics is the world's leading producer
of high-performance engineered polymer solutions. With 50 locations
in 17 countries the company is positioned to provide innovative
products and services to a global customer base.
The Microelectronic Business supplies a complete line of
semiconductor grade fluid handling products. Providing customer
oriented solutions the product line includes pumps, valves,
fittings, integrated manifolds, high-purity pipe and tubing. For
